Monday Read

Ease into your monday by sipping on that venti coffee and reading Malcolm Gladwell’s latest piece in The New Yorker.  Gladwell examines Harper Lee’s Atticus Finch, the real-life Alabama Governor Big Jim Folsom (role model for Finch and possibly O Brother’s Pappy O’Daniel), and old-style Southern liberalism.  It’s worth your time.
